Are you a collector?
Everywhere you look, people are collecting something. My weaknesses? Tolkien books, sci-fi DVDs, and craft ales, among other things. I used to have a vinyl collection, then cassettes, CDs, mini discs, and finally digital downloads. Then streaming changed everything. Like many people, I reasoned that I could either spend £9.99 a month on one album or the same amount for access to millions of songs. I was seduced by streaming services. I enjoyed playlists and the endless back catalogues of my favorite artists, but something was missing—ownership. I had nothing tangible to show for my hours of listening. How many live music venues in your town have closed down? How many of your friends are in a band? When did you last go to a gig? Livestreams are great for connecting artists and fans, but can they ever replace the thrill of buying a record, supporting your favorite band, or queuing up for their latest release? Songcards could be the solution. It’s a way to actively support new music and musicians—a platform for music collectors who genuinely love discovering fresh talent. The app includes a built-in high-quality player, and you can easily migrate your collection from the desktop app to mobile. The Songcards you buy are yours to keep, and the money goes directly to the musicians who made your new favorite songs. Christopher has spent years developing Songcards alongside artists, creating a clever and simple way for collectors to support musicians.
